BugHerd integrations

BugHerd provides deep two-way integrations with the popular project management tools and developer tools your team already uses.

INTEGRATIONS FOR PROJECT MANAGEMENT

BugHerd’s deep two-way integrations with Jira, Asana, ClickUp, Monday.com, Trello, Linear, Productive, and Teamwork keep feedback visible where work happens.

DEV & QA INTEGRATIONS

BugHerd integrates with developer and QA tools to create end-to-end traceability between client feedback and code fixes.

icon - integration - github

GitHub

Automatically create GitHub issues from BugHerd tasks and update BugHerd status using commit hooks when completed in GitHub.
link arrow blue
fullstory icon

FullStory

Automatically detects FullStory sessions and links them to feedback, giving you instant access to user session replays. No setup required.
link arrow blue
logrocket icon

LogRocket

Automatically detects LogRocket sessions and links them to feedback, giving you instant access to user session replays. No setup required.
link arrow blue
lambdatest icon

LambdaTest

Send issues found during testing directly to BugHerd with browser and OS details.
link arrow blue

BugHerd ensures each task includes the full technical context developers need to reproduce and resolve issues quickly.

Frequently asked questions

BugHerd integrates seamlessly with your workflow – turning visual feedback into connected, actionable tasks across every major project, collaboration, and developer platform. Here’s the answer to some commonly asked questions to help you discover if BugHerd is the right tool for you.
Does BugHerd integrate with Jira?

Yes. BugHerd integrates with Jira to create issues automatically from client feedback. The Jira integration supports two-way sync for tasks/issues, comments and status updates.

Does BugHerd integrate with Asana?

Yes. BugHerd integrates with Asana using a two-way connection that keeps tasks, comments, and completion status synchronized in both platforms.

Can BugHerd integrate with ClickUp and Monday.com?

Yes. BugHerd integrates with ClickUp and Monday.com for two-way synchronization of comments and task updates, keeping project boards aligned automatically.

Does BugHerd integrate with Slack or Microsoft Teams?

Yes. BugHerd integrates with Slack and Microsoft Teams for one-way notifications, alerting teams when new feedback or updates are added.

Does BugHerd integrate with developer tools like GitHub?

Yes. BugHerd integrates with GitHub to create issues automatically from client feedback and allows you to automatically update status in BugHerd when a commit is made.

Can BugHerd integrate with testing tools?

Yes. BugHerd integrates LambdaTest to attach user session replays and browser test details to feedback tasks.

Does BugHerd support automation platforms?

Yes. BugHerd integrates with Zapier and Integrately allowing you to build custom automations for task creation, status updates, and other workflows.

Can BugHerd connect to WordPress or Drupal?

Yes. BugHerd can be easily embedded in WordPress and Drupal using our plugins to capture on-page feedback directly from live websites.

Does BugHerd have an API and webhook support?

Yes. BugHerd offers a full REST API and webhook system that enables you to build custom integrations with your own internal tools.
